1994 Land Rover Range Rover vs. 1984 GMC Jimmy

To start off, 1994 Land Rover Range Rover is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1984 GMC Jimmy.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1984 GMC Jimmy would be higher. At 4,554 cc (8 cylinders), 1994 Land Rover Range Rover is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Land Rover Range Rover (223 HP) has 142 more horse power than 1984 GMC Jimmy. (81 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1994 Land Rover Range Rover should accelerate faster than 1984 GMC Jimmy.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1994 Land Rover Range Rover weights approximately 825 kg more than 1984 GMC Jimmy.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Land Rover Range Rover (381 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 235 more torque (in Nm) than 1984 GMC Jimmy. (146 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 1994 Land Rover Range Rover will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1984 GMC Jimmy.
